Oasis is an non profit charity that provides a warm, welsh welcome to Refugees and Asylum Seekers in Cardiff. They provide a range of activities including ESOL classes, arts and crafts, sport and music, women and family activities, day trips and a hot meal Monday to Friday at 12:30pm. Space4U is a drop-in for Refugees and Asylum Seekers. It is a safe, friendly space that also provides ESOL classes, free refreshments, clothing for AS in Initial Accommodation, help and information.

The Trinity Centre offers a place where the local community can meet, share and learn from their experiences of life in a safe environment. You will find many local organisations running sessions at Trinity for refugees and asylum seekers providing support, food, english classes and more.
